Tesco renamed as Lotus’s after 2020 acquisition by CP Group

Tesco made the official announcement yesterday of renaming its stores as Lotuss Stores or Lotus’s Malaysia after customers noticed signs and notices of rebranding throughout its stores. According to the company’s Facebook page, the full rebranding exercise will be completed by the end of 2021.

Charoen Pokphand Group Co., Ltd (CP Group) acquired Tesco Stores (Malaysia) Sdn Bhd in December last year and the Thai group bought over the British retailer for an enterprise value of USD10.6 billion.
